src.ctf.lttng-live: use optional pattern for `ctf_stream_class_id`
[babeltrace.git] / src / plugins / ctf / lttng-live / data-stream.c
index 618af36d643910715ff5ad77ed461e556cb39701..e8f00d7f561f34f25957f60a3d8b920a9340b465 100644 (file)
@@ -222,8 +222,12 @@ struct lttng_live_stream_iterator *lttng_live_stream_iterator_create(
        stream_iter->trace = trace;
        stream_iter->state = LTTNG_LIVE_STREAM_ACTIVE_NO_DATA;
        stream_iter->viewer_stream_id = stream_id;
-       stream_iter->ctf_stream_class_id = -1ULL;
-       stream_iter->last_inactivity_ts = INT64_MIN;
+
+       stream_iter->ctf_stream_class_id.is_set = false;
+       stream_iter->ctf_stream_class_id.value = UINT64_MAX;
+
+       stream_iter->last_inactivity_ts.is_set = false;
+       stream_iter->last_inactivity_ts.value = 0;
 
        if (trace->trace) {
                struct ctf_trace_class *ctf_tc =
This page took 0.024351 seconds and 4 git commands to generate.